The Texas Class of 2026 features a deep group of shooting guards who consistently produced against high-level competition across the state and national circuits. This group blends size on the perimeter, scoring ability, and defensive versatility, with several players proving themselves against some of the toughest schedules in Texas. Many of these guards played major roles in deep playoff runs, state championship games, and national-level events. As the final evaluation of their high school careers, these ten shooting guards separated themselves through production, consistency, and impact in winning environments.
